Output e7ffaa08104fc9dff5198ac91f14303deec921e2c45e36a2563734c00b252f14:3

value
639421222
script pubkey
OP_0 OP_PUSHBYTES_20 bb7a522df774dc8f9aa0f20f5bb7d472b64a3a8a
address
bc1qhda9yt0hwnwglx4q7g84hd75w2my5w5297wa6k
transaction
e7ffaa08104fc9dff5198ac91f14303deec921e2c45e36a2563734c00b252f14
spent
true